BYD aims to increase coverage of new energy vehicle market in 2015

Gasgoo.com (Shanghai January 29) - BYD has announced its new energy vehicle plan for the year at an event in Shenzhen earlier this week, the Beijing Times reported today. At the event, BYD CEO Wang Chuanfu stated that the manufacturer is planning to build brand new product supply lines for new energy vehicles, allowing BYD to cover all segments in the new energy vehicle market.

Mr. Wang (pictured) emphasized BYD’s intention to offer new energy alternatives to all of its traditional automobiles under its new 7 4 plan. BYD will offer a full host of plug-in electric hybrid including plug-in electric hybrids ranging from sedans to SUVs. The manufacturer is also working with Daimler to create the Denza own brand to target the pure electric vehicle market. BYD also looks to strengthen its portfolio of public transit vehicles, including pure electric buses, as well as expand into the commercial vehicle sector with new energy dump trucks and forklifts.
